Capillary Nail Refill Test
Alternate Names : Capillary Refill Time, CRT, Nail Blanch Test
DefinitionThis quick test is performed on the nail beds o monitor tissue perfusion (the amount of blood flow to tissue) and dehydration.

Why is the Test Performed?
Oxygen, which is critical to the survival of tissue, is carried to various parts of the body by the blood (vascular) system. This test measures how well the vascular system is functioning in your extremities. If you are dehydrated, or tissue perfusion is blocked by other means, this quick test can alert you or your health care provider that care needs to be taken to restore normal vascular flow.
